Airpax Tackpak-3 Process Module - Digital Process Tachometer, TYPE/DIGITAL 120/24VDC-10W Max Standard NEMA 1 Enclosure 2.7 Ibs Net Weight Simple Type: PLC Process Control Module

TACH-PAK 3 is a single-input industrial tachometer that measures the rate of events. Using various sensors, TACH-PAK 3 can measure events as simple as the speed of a rotating shaft, the rate at which paper passes through a press, or as diverse as the rate at which liquid flows through a pump. A speed sensor placed near a target, such as a rotating gear, generates a repeating electrical pulse. The rate of repetition is proportional to the rate of the event you want to measure and represents the input frequency. TACH-PAK 3 measures this rate in number of pulses per second (hertz). This input signal from the sensor is conditioned, analyzed by a microcomputer and routed to the outputs. TACH-PAK 3’s microcomputer uses a scheme of data acquisition called adaptive period averaging, a unique frequency measuring method in which the number of periods averaged changes with the frequency to obtain optimal accuracy. At input frequencies of 100 Hz and above, the outputs are updated every 30 milliseconds.

Features

  • 0-1 mA DC meter output
  • 0-20/4-20 mA DC analog output
  • Four Form C (SPDT) relay setpoints

Specifications

    General
  • -40º to 80ºC (-40º to 176ºF) (storage)
  • Analog filter (2 second time constant), switch-selectable
  • CMRR : >40 db @ 1 kHz ref., to input amplifier threshold
  • Full scale selectable from 0 Hz to 30 kHz
  • Logic 0 : V in < .5 V
  • Logic 1 : V in > 1.5 V
  • Lower limit is software selectable from .0625 Hz to 10 Hz.
  • Max. voltage input : 25 Vrms
  • Min. pulse width : 10 µs
  • Sensitivity @ 1 kHz : 200 mVrms
  • AC Input(sine wave): Input impedance : 2000 ohms
  • Constant Storage: Retained in EAROM and may be altered 1000 or more times
  • Enclosure: NEMA 1, 4X, 7 & 9 enclosures are available, see Section 3.2.
  • Frequency Range: Upper limit 30 kHz
  • Humidity: 90% relative and non-condensing
  • Meter Output: 0 to 1.0 mA ±5%. True current, 15k ohm maximum loop resistance.
  • Pulse Input (TTL-compatible): Input impedance : 2000 ohms
  • Shock: Designed to meet MIL 810C, Method 516.2, Procedure I, Fig 516.2-2 for ground equipment (30 G half sine)
  • Signal Input: Type: Active or passive pickup determined by software settings (jumper required for active pickups).
  • Temperature: -10º to 55ºC (14º to 131ºF) (operating)
  • Vibration: Designed to meet MIL 810C, Method 514.2, Procedure VIII, Fig. 514.2-6. Curve V (15 G 10-200 Hz)
